The idle timeout, is for locking the client out after X time after the user hasn't used the device. This is not to be used for increasing the transmit timeouts.
To increase the transmit timeout, go into the cockpit under the application. Go to the "App Specific Settings" and you need to increase the following section key:
Server -> InactiveTimeout